    US Army Reserve soldiers help thousands by manning pharmacy

    SANTA RITA, HONDURAS

    06.30.2012

    Photo by 1st Lt. John Quin 

    70th Mobile Public Affairs Detachment

    Soldiers from the 548th and 444th Minimal Care Detachments worked with fellow Reservists from the 478th Civil Affairs Battalion and Honduran agencies during a medical mission in Santa Rita, Honduras, June 30.
